Learn canning tips at Coshocton County Fair
Free class April 29 covers safe canning practices with OSU expert
Curious about what it takes to earn a blue ribbon with canned foods at the Coshocton County Fair? Come learn about the judging criteria for canned foods categories while exploring recommendations for safely canning foods.
Emily Marrison, family and consumer sciences educator, will teach about the differences between water bath canning and pressure canning and why it is important to use the correct process to produce safe, high-quality food. Participants will be able to view different types of canners, jars, lids and other helpful tools.
The Blue Ribbon Canning Class will be from 5:30-7 p.m. Wednesday, April 29 at the Coshocton County Services Building, 724 S. Seventh St., room 145, Coshocton. The class is free, but registration is required at go.osu.edu/blueribboncanning. Call OSU Extension with questions at 740-622-2265 or email marrison.12@osu.edu.
